Chipbreaker Profile
The SGM 3-flute square series features an advanced chipbreaker geometry optimized for high-efficiency milling:
- Variable Helix Design (38°): Suppresses regenerative vibration and extends tool life in unstable setups
- Positive Rake Face: Reduces cutting forces by 15% compared to conventional geometries, minimizing deflection in long-reach applications
- Polished Flute Surface: Mirror-finish flutes prevent chip adhesion and built-up edge, critical for stainless steel machining
- Core Thickness Optimization: 35% core ratio provides maximum rigidity for the tapered neck while maintaining chip evacuation
- Sharp Cutting Edge: Honing preparation ensures clean shearing action and reduced burr formation

Recommended Cutting Conditions
| Material | Vc (m/min) | fz (mm/tooth) | ap max (mm) | ae max (mm)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Carbon Steel (C45) | 90 | 0.004 | 0.914 | 0.732 |
| Stainless Steel (304) | 70 | 0.003 | 0.686 | 0.549 |
| Cast Iron (GG25) | 110 | 0.005 | 1.143 | 0.914 |
| Aluminum (6061-T6) | 180 | 0.008 | 1.372 | 1.097 |
Note: Values are starting recommendations for stable setups. Reduce parameters by 20-30% for long-overhang or deep-cavity applications. Use high-pressure coolant for stainless steel and titanium alloys. Always verify spindle speed and feed rate against machine capabilities.
Operating Guidelines
- Tool Runout: Maintain TIR ≤ 0.005 mm at the tool tip for optimal tool life and surface finish
- Coolant Strategy: Flood coolant or through-spindle coolant (TSC) recommended; for aluminum, consider air blast or MQL to prevent chip re-cutting
- Entry Strategy: Use helical or ramping entry at 2-3° angle; avoid direct plunging with square endmills
- Radial Engagement: For roughing, ae = 0.6-0.8 × D1; for finishing, ae = 0.1-0.2 × D1
- Axial Depth: For slotting, ap ≤ 1.0 × D1; for profiling, ap ≤ 1.5 × D1 with reduced ae
- Chip Evacuation: Ensure adequate coolant pressure (≥70 bar for TSC) to clear chips from deep cavities
- Tool Inspection: Check for coating wear, edge chipping, and neck deflection after extended use
Toolholder Compatibility
| Holder Type | Compatibility |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Hydraulic Chucks | ✓ Recommended | Best damping for long-reach tools; TIR < 0.003 mm |
| Shrink Fit Holders | ✓ Recommended | Excellent rigidity and concentricity for high-speed operations |
| ER Collet Systems (ER16/ER20) | ✓ Compatible | Use precision collets (AA grade); minimize protrusion |
| Milling Chucks | ✓ Compatible | Suitable for general milling; ensure proper torque |
| Side-Lock Endmill Holders | △ Not Recommended | May cause runout issues; avoid for precision work |
